Licensing & Eligibility in Pennsylvania

Pennsylvania employment attorneys must be admitted to the Pennsylvania Bar to practice in Montgomery County courts. The Eastern District of Pennsylvania requires separate federal admission for employment cases involving federal agencies or federal employment law claims.

How does Pennsylvania employment law affect cases in Montgomery County?
Pennsylvania follows at-will employment but recognizes public policy exceptions and provides strong protections under the Pennsylvania Human Relations Act. Montgomery County cases often involve both state and federal employment law claims requiring comprehensive legal strategies.
